Output fdab8ba7445537ec95f6da01f51f66c251f0434e7328eeae7d1a969c56fb1f0e:11

value
67582791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ec3a4587daeadb043aa1695588570f4dedb8429d OP_EQUAL
address
3PE5CbdAjbiJpYJxiospEZGdn4Er5yRZ7b
transaction
fdab8ba7445537ec95f6da01f51f66c251f0434e7328eeae7d1a969c56fb1f0e
spent
true